I loved my Ghost Max 1. They have been the best running shoe I've run in by far, and I've been running for forty years. It's been a real game changer for me. My marathon distances haven't caused any friction on my feet, and the ride is so comfortable I don't have to think about my feet at all. I tried on the Ghost Max 2 in our local running store, same size as the last time, and the fit is completely different. There's so little room in the toe box. Before, in the Max 1, the width, the length, and the height of the toe box had been perfect. I purchased a couple of pairs of the Max 1 on sale and have them waiting for me under my bed. When I run through those I don't know what I'll do. Please bring back the original fit.

Overall, i really like the shoe. it's got a more firm sole compared to the glycerin. the tongue is cushy and doesn't bug me when running or walking. i use the shoe for both. its true to size. i dont feel squeezed or like im flopping around in it. it feels like a really good fit. i typically need insoles in any shoe and these, i don't. this shoe gives good support for my arches (i have high arches). the only complaints i have are the tongue is VERY cushioned and so it's tricky to get a good tightness without holding the laces tight as you tighten the laces up the shoe. and secondly, i wish all the colors came in wide and not just select ones.
